Why 3 Phase Power Demands a Hybrid BESS Like itel
Standard single-phase systems simply can't handle the higher power demands and balanced load requirements common in European homes with heat pumps, EV chargers, or commercial equipment. Attempting to retrofit single-phase storage often leads to:
- Phase Imbalance: Overloading one phase while others sit underutilized, stressing your local grid connection.
- Limited Power Output: Inability to start high-torque machinery or charge EVs at maximum speed.
- Inefficient Self-Consumption: Excess solar on one phase can't easily power loads on another without grid interaction.
